Poll: Joe Manchin to Lose Support Among West Virginians If He Votes for Democrats’ Amnesty Plan

John Binder 14 Jul 2021

Sen. Joe Manchin (D-WV) will lose support among West Virginians come re-election time if he votes for a Democrat budget, via filibuster-proof reconciliation, that includes amnesty for millions of illegal aliens, a poll provided to Breitbart News reveals.

On Wednesday, Manchin reportedly voiced support for giving amnesty to illegal aliens through a Democrat budget that would only be approved via reconciliation — a maneuver that allows Senate Democrats to pass a variety of agenda items with just 51 votes and no threat of a filibuster.

A poll provided to Breitbart News from the Federation for American Immigration Reform (FAIR), conducted by Zogby Analytics, finds that should Manchin vote for the amnesty-filled budget, he will lose significant support from West Virginians.

About 55 percent of likely West Virginia voters said they would be less likely to support Manchin if he votes for the Democrats’ amnesty plan. Just 24 percent of likely West Virginia voters said they would be more likely to support Manchin if he votes for the plan.

Similarly, 52 percent of likely West Virginia voters said they oppose slipping an amnesty into a federal budget via reconciliation, whereas only 34 percent said they support the maneuver. Likewise, 52 percent said they oppose putting amnesty for illegal aliens into any infrastructure package while 34 percent said they support doing so.

Manchin’s support for amnesty via reconciliation is significant because he, along with Sen. Kyrsten Sinema (D-AZ), is considered one of the most moderate Democrats in the Senate and has consistently opposed ending the filibuster.
